The Samyang Kimbap

Yes, folks, you didn’t read that wrong. Samyang has a new flavour in town, and this time it comes in the form of a Korean rice roll:

An honest to goodness Samyang Kimbap.

Image: Airfrov

Rice drenched in buldak-bokkeum-myeon-flavour is enwrapped around shredded carrots, omelette and a hefty chunk of chicken luncheon meat, with a strip of crispy seaweed holding everything in place and in the process, constituting a perfectly filling ready-to-eat meal.

Well, if you’re based in Singapore or Malaysia right now, I regret to inform you that the kimbap won’t be available at any local stores just yet, as the product was only recently launched over in South Korea.
